IPFS

IPFS (InterPlanetary File System) is a peer-to-peer distributed file system that seeks to connect all computing devices with the same system of files.
In some ways, IPFS is similar to the World Wide Web, but IPFS could be seen as a single BitTorrent swarm, exchanging objects within one Git repository. In other words, IPFS provides a high-throughput, content-addressed block storage model, with content-addressed hyperlinks. This forms a generalized Merkle directed acyclic graph (DAG).
IPFS combines a distributed hash table, an incentivized block exchange, and a self-certifying namespace. IPFS has no single point of failure, and nodes do not need to trust each other, except for every node they are connected to. Distributed Content Delivery saves bandwidth and prevents distributed denial-of-service (DDoS) attacks, a problem common with HTTP.
- GitHub: https://github.com/topics/ipfs
- Wikipedia: https://en.wikipedia.org/wiki/InterPlanetary_File_System
- Repo: https://github.com/ipfs/ipfs
- Created by: Juan Benet
- Released: May 23, 2014
- Aliases: ipfs-daemon, ipfs-api, ipfs-webui, js-ipfs, ipfs-protocol, go-ipfs,
- Last updated: 2025-05-08 00:15:23 UTC
- JSON Representation
https://github.com/travelxml/polygon-nft-marketplace
Polygon NFT marketplace showcasing the creation, trading, and management of NFTs on the Polygon blockchain. Ideal for developers exploring decentralized applications and blockchain technology
blockchain blockchain-demos blockchain-technology dapp dapps dapps-development dappsys hardhat hardhat-node ipfs ipfs-blockchain nextjs nft nft-marketplace nodejs polygon solidity-contracts solidity-dapps web3
Last synced: 19 Nov 2024
https://github.com/chunrapeepat/buildquest
Get earn instantly when your PR gets merged.
bounty dapp ethereum grant grants-management ipfs web3
Last synced: 12 Apr 2025
https://github.com/tchardin/myel-ethonline
Content retrieval payment manager
Last synced: 10 Apr 2025
https://github.com/bit-nation/bitnation-registry
The Pangea Jurisdiction registry for Citizens, Nations, Holons, Embassies, Consulates, Ports etc
Last synced: 11 Apr 2025
https://github.com/metafam/dacademy
WIP - New build of standalone dAcademy
appkit envio ipfs nfts optimism react reown shadcn storacha tailwindcss tanstack-query tanstack-router thegraph typescript ucan viem vite wagmi web3 web3storage
Last synced: 21 Jan 2025
https://github.com/ericglau/ipfs-deploy
Java tools for deploying to and reading from decentralized Maven repositories on IPFS/Filecoin.
Last synced: 24 Mar 2025
https://github.com/compscidr/ipfs_indexer
An ipfs indexer / search engine built in rust
hacktoberfest indexer ipfs rust rust-lang
Last synced: 02 May 2025
https://github.com/fiatjaf/piln
loginless pin to ipfs with lightning network payments
Last synced: 19 Mar 2025
https://github.com/fission-codes/discourse-ipfs-file-store
A Discourse plugin to use IPFS to store files
discourse discourse-plugins ipfs
Last synced: 10 Apr 2025
https://github.com/mukundan314/dcall
(WIP) P2P Video Conferencing
hacktoberfest ipfs p2p video-conferencing
Last synced: 14 Apr 2025
https://github.com/fiatjaf/gravity
IPFS centralized index protocol and tooling
Last synced: 16 Jan 2025
https://github.com/mikeshultz/ethereum-pinner
Pins IPFS hashes according to events from a contract
Last synced: 11 Feb 2025
https://github.com/fission-codes/basquiat
Interplanetary Image Metadata Resizer
Last synced: 10 Apr 2025
https://github.com/ipshipyard/ipns-inspector
inspect and create IPNS records from the browser
Last synced: 09 Apr 2025
https://github.com/chainstacklabs/generative-ai-music-nft-javascript
This project contains all tutorial files from the How to mint a generative music NFT with Chainstack IPFS Storage and Soundraw tutorial, originally published on the Chainstack Developer Portal: Web3 [De]Coded.
generative-ai generative-art generative-music ipfs ipfs-api nft nft-generator nfts smartcontract
Last synced: 21 Jan 2025
https://github.com/nu0ma/ipfs-uploader
Upload the data to IPFS and get IPFS's link. ( https://ipfsuploader-d6luh021e.now.sh/)
ipfs ipfs-api react react-hooks react-router semantic-ui-react typescript
Last synced: 19 Jan 2025
https://github.com/semiott/rheanet
Digital Dispute Resolution System for Sports Streaming Services Powered by Ethereum Engineering Ecosystem
arbitrum chainlink chainlink-adapter defi dispute-resolution ethereum ipfs nft rollups shipping trade-finance
Last synced: 18 Nov 2024
https://github.com/chainstacklabs/music-nft-minter-tutorial-repo
This project contains all tutorial files from the How to mint a music NFT: Dropping fire tunes with Chainstack IPFS Storage tutorial, originally published on the Chainstack Developer Portal: Web3 [De]Coded.
ipfs ipfs-api nft nft-generator nfts smartcontract
Last synced: 21 Jan 2025
https://github.com/aidenwong812/tomi-browser
A fast, minimal browser that protects your privacy. Resolve ENS names and redirects to an IPFS gateway. Supports custom search engine and proxies including Socks5
crossplatform electron ens ethereum ipfs javascript proxy search-engine socks5
Last synced: 21 Jan 2025
https://github.com/stevedylandev/pi-widget
A small Go server that displays live data of my Raspberry Pi
golang ipfs radicle raspberry-pi
Last synced: 21 Jan 2025
https://github.com/octipus/dappstore-eth-ipfs
Decentralized application using Ethereum blockchain and IPFS
blockchain dapp decentralized ecommerce ipfs
Last synced: 16 Mar 2025
https://github.com/greenpill-dev-guild/green-goods
Bringing biodiversity data onchain to better measure, track and reward impact on gardens.
attestations biodiversity biodiversity-monitoring community conservation environment ethereum foundry greenpill impact ipfs public-goods pwa regenerative smart-contracts solidity tailwindcss typescript vite web3
Last synced: 23 Jan 2025
https://github.com/mkmik/zerozone
Zero Zone is a (proof of concept) Zero Conf public domain registrar
Last synced: 13 Apr 2025
https://github.com/barabazs/py-is_ipfs
py-is_ipfs is a Python library to identify valid IPFS resources.
cid decentralization ipfs ipns validation validation-library
Last synced: 14 Apr 2025
https://github.com/ipfs-shipyard/www-helia-identify
Run identify with a peer with Helia in a browser
Last synced: 13 Apr 2025
https://github.com/salmandabbakuti/lit-password-manager
Password manager with Lit for encryption and Ipfs for storage
blockchain dapp decentralized-applications ethereum graphql indexing-querying ipfs lit-protocol password-manager thegraph web3
Last synced: 07 May 2025
https://github.com/amateescu/ipfs
Provides Drupal integration with IPFS
decentralized-applications drupal ipfs
Last synced: 15 Apr 2025
https://github.com/oduwsdl/ipns-blockchain
An IPNS implementation using Blockchain with Memento support
archiving blockchain ipfs ipns memento
Last synced: 15 Apr 2025
https://github.com/kiwix/ipfs-portal
Web portal to access Wikipedia snapshots published on IPFS
Last synced: 18 Nov 2024
https://github.com/nugaon/purity
Browse new web contents on the P2P networks with this Ethereum blockchain based application
blockchain decentralised decentralised-internet etehereum geth ipfs web3
Last synced: 12 Feb 2025
https://github.com/bunnykek/ethereum-ipfs-filehosting
Secure way to host and share your files with smart contracts and decentralized IPFS storage.
blockchain file-sharing ipfs smart-contracts sveltekit
Last synced: 21 Jan 2025
https://github.com/artus/ipfs-notepad
Notepad for ipfs files.
blockchain decentralization decentralized ipfs ipfs-blockchain js-ipfs notepad text-editor
Last synced: 20 Jan 2025
https://github.com/crustio/crust-cli
The Crust command-line interface (Crust CLI) is a set of commands used to access Crust Network resources
Last synced: 19 Nov 2024
https://github.com/indreklasn/ipfs-node-example
How To Get Started With IPFS and Node
Last synced: 14 Apr 2025
https://github.com/asabya/ipfs-monitor
ipfs monitor for terminal
ipfs ipfs-api ipfs-monitor ipfs-node-monitor
Last synced: 21 Jan 2025
https://github.com/net2devcrypto/web3-user-profiles-part4
Generate custom ERC wallets and assign them to your user accounts. These will be internal wallets only accessible by the App developers just like a centralized exchange.
erc ethereum ipfs metamask mongodb nextjs polygon profiles web3
Last synced: 02 Dec 2024
https://github.com/valyriantech/ipfs_dict_chain
ipfs_dict_chain is a Python package that provides IPFSDict and IPFSDictChain objects, which are dictionary-like data structures that store their state on IPFS and keep track of changes, basically creating a mini-blockchain of dicts on IPFS for efficient and secure data management.
Last synced: 10 Apr 2025
https://github.com/filedrive-team/go-parallel-graphsync
Parallel-GraphSync is an enhanced implementation for parallel synchronization of large IPLD graph data based on GraphSync protocol.
Last synced: 10 Apr 2025
https://github.com/Developerayo/deploy-nuxtjs-using-ipfs-on-fleek
Deploying A NuxtJS App Using IPFS On Fleek
fleek ipfs javascript nuxtjs tailwindcss
Last synced: 18 Jan 2025
https://github.com/aidenwong812/tomi-chat-web
Tomi Mesh is an chat application utilizing XMTP. It allows users to connect various wallet applications, engage in chat conversations, and supports accessibility and localization.
chatapp cypress ipfs offchain react tailwindcss vite walletconnect xmtp
Last synced: 21 Dec 2024
https://github.com/iand/mfsng
An implementation of Go's filesystem interface for the IPFS UnixFS format.
Last synced: 19 Apr 2025
https://github.com/johackim/johackim.com
My personal digital garden 🌱
design-system digital-garden docker eslint ipfs mdx nextjs obsidian react tailwindcss
Last synced: 24 Apr 2025
https://github.com/creazy231/nuxt-ipfs
Static Website hosting using Nuxt + IPFS
Last synced: 18 Jan 2025
https://github.com/rtradeltd/temporal-js
javascript and typescript sdk for using Temporal
ipfs javascript js-ipfs js-ipfs-http-client sdk temporal temporal-js typescript
Last synced: 19 Jan 2025
https://github.com/ipfs-shipyard/ignite-metrics
Metrics consent and client provider library for ipfs/ipfs-gui team (i.e. IPFS Ignite). See ipfs/ipfs-gui#129 for more details
Last synced: 25 Jan 2025
https://github.com/ipfs-shipyard/js-ipfs-versidag
Concurrent version history based on a Merkle-DAG on top of IPFS and IPLD
concurrent history ipfs merkle-dag version
Last synced: 19 Apr 2025
https://github.com/yannbouyeron/ipfs-api
Application html/JS permettant de poster du contenu sur IPFS
ipfs ipfs-api ipfs-blockchain ipfs-web
Last synced: 21 Jan 2025
https://github.com/mikolalysenko/hawaii-navigator
Proof of concept peer to peer navigator for Hawaii
gps hawaii ipfs navigation planning router
Last synced: 06 Apr 2025
https://github.com/ranjancse26/scalablenftapi
An highly scalable SaaS-Based NFT API for generating the NFT Artwork using a custom generative algorithm. Uses NFT Storage as its the backend to persist the NFT Artwork
Last synced: 29 Apr 2025
https://github.com/pontiyaraja/ipfs-pubsub
Ipfs publish and subscribe in Golang
ipfs ipfs-api ipfs-blockchain ipfs-pubsub ipfs-pubsub-room publish-subscribe pubsub
Last synced: 07 Apr 2025
https://github.com/tallylab/tallylab
TallyLab is a local-first, end-to-end encrypted data diary app for capturing, analyzing, and sharing data concerning any and everything.
data-visualization end-to-end-encryption ipfs local-first orbit-db personal-tracking
Last synced: 12 Apr 2025
https://github.com/reaperdragon/web3-youtube
Web3 YoutTube is Decentralize YouTube Clone Built with Next Js, Hardhat, Solidity, IPFS, The Graph Protocol and Tailwind CSS.📹
apolloclient blockchain ethereum ethersjs graphql hardhat ipfs ipfs-client javascript nextjs openzeppelin-contracts react-hooks reactjs smart-contracts solidity tailwindcss thegraphprotocol typescript youtube
Last synced: 20 Dec 2024
https://github.com/fahamutech/keshatv
Decentralised on demand video and tv-shows streaming
ai ipfs javascript movies p2p peer-to-peer react tvshows web3
Last synced: 04 Mar 2025
https://github.com/net2devcrypto/ai-nft-art-contract-web3-site-generator-js
This app will auto generate your NFT Collection Art using OpenAI. It will generate each NFT Metadata as well, Upload all of it to IPFS, auto create the smart contract then auto deploy it to the blockchain. It will also create the mint portal so you can sell the nfts!
ai ipfs metadata nft openai starton web3
Last synced: 02 Dec 2024
https://github.com/open-services/clj-ipfs-api
HTTP client for a IPFS daemon
Last synced: 10 Apr 2025
https://github.com/questnetwork/qd-social-ts
Decentralized End-To-End Encrypted P2P Social Network Module For qDesk
Last synced: 03 Apr 2025
https://github.com/largenft/large-nft
An open source and decentralized CMS for Ethereum & IPFS that runs offline-first in the browser.
Last synced: 17 Dec 2024
https://github.com/net2devcrypto/decentralized-web3-front-end
Build a Static HTML Web3 Frontend that can be hosted in IPFS to have a true serverless, decentralized web3 application.
blockchain decentralized-applications ethersjs html-css-javascript ipfs nextjs serverless-framework static-site web3 web3js
Last synced: 02 Dec 2024
https://github.com/victorb/ipfs-hack-day-barcelona-october-2017
IPFS Hack Day Barcelona - October 2017
barcelona event hack-days ipfs
Last synced: 22 Feb 2025
https://github.com/tableflip/share-via-ipfs
Share files with friends over IPFS
Last synced: 06 Apr 2025
https://github.com/net2devcrypto/web3-pinata-ipfs-real-estate-app
🎉Build a Real Estate Listing App in NextJS Using IPFS and Pinata
decentralized decentralized-applications decentralized-storage ipfs nextjs pinata web3
Last synced: 02 Dec 2024
https://github.com/datatogether/sql_datastore
Experimental Golang implementation of the ipfs datastore interface for sql databases.
datastore-interface golang ipfs package sql
Last synced: 25 Jan 2025
https://github.com/fission-codes/go-car-mirror
Generic Go implementation of the CAR Mirror protocol
car-file car-mirror content-addressing golang ipfs
Last synced: 10 Apr 2025
https://github.com/tthebc01/cloud-in-a-box
Docker stack template with form-based login, browser IDE, resource monitoring, and object storage.
caddy2 cadvisor docker glances grafana ipfs prometheus-metrics supervisord theia-ide
Last synced: 03 Jan 2025
https://github.com/dimchansky/ipfs-add
Tool to add a file or directory to IPFS
Last synced: 17 Dec 2024
https://github.com/jmcph4/azorian
C11 implementation of multiformat specifications
c c11 data-structures formats ipfs ipld ipns libp2p multiaddr multibase multiformat multiformat-specifications multiformats multihash multiprotocol p2p self-describing unsigned-varint varint
Last synced: 12 Apr 2025
https://github.com/aviondb/aviondb-specs
Specs for AvionDB
database ipfs orbitdb orbitdb-stores schemas
Last synced: 04 Apr 2025
https://github.com/mmsaki/dog-registry-blockchain-app
This app uses smart contracts and blockchain technology in a real world application to verify and store data for dog registries to keep track of their health, breeding, previous owners and report on the their their breeders using Dog NFTs.
blockchain erc721-tokens ethereum ipfs metamask nfts pinata remix-ide smart-contracts solidity solidity-contracts streamlit web3py
Last synced: 06 Apr 2025
https://github.com/functionland/fula-archived
Client-server stack for Web3! Turn your Raspberry Pi to a BAS server in minutes and enjoy the freedom of decentralized Web with a superior user experience!
decentralized filecoin ipfs libp2p nas raspberry-pi serverless web3
Last synced: 03 Dec 2024
https://github.com/suprasummus/ipfs-execute
Pure containers using Bubblewrap and IPFS
bubblewrap containers ipfs pure-functional
Last synced: 17 Mar 2025
https://github.com/likecoin/likecoin-poc
Meme Generator - a proof of concept of LikeCoin content footprint
Last synced: 08 Apr 2025
https://github.com/vinarmani/agoratube
Javascript add-on for js-ipfs for browser-based media sharing over IPFS
html5-video-player ipfs javascript js-ipfs peer-to-peer
Last synced: 20 Jan 2025
https://github.com/dozyio/js-blockstore-encrypt
Encrypted Blockstore for IPFS / Helia
blockstore encryption helia ipfs
Last synced: 14 Apr 2025
https://github.com/storj-thirdparty/connector-ipfs
IPFS connector to the Storj protocol; use this to backup your data from IPFS to the leading decentralized storage network.
Last synced: 18 Nov 2024
https://github.com/whenubelieve/react-ipfs-proxy-api-manager-go
I made a docker-compose.yml that built everything but for some reason the proxy didn't work correctly within the container and I didn't want to spend much time finding the problem, so we have to do this manually
api docker-compose go golang ipfs manager proxy react
Last synced: 25 Dec 2024
https://github.com/bethanyuo/casino-dapp
Deploy a Casino DApp on IPFS.
dapp infura ipfs truffle truffle-framework
Last synced: 04 May 2025
https://github.com/mediolano-app/mediolano-stark
Mediolano dapp blueprint @ Starknet
blockchain cairo dapp ethereum intellectual-property ip ipfs nextjs react starknet
Last synced: 21 Jan 2025
https://github.com/fission-codes/ipfs-api-clients
Client libraries for the IPFS API - Clojure, C#, Elixir, Elm, Erlang, Go, Java, JS, Kotlin, PHP, Python, Rust, Scala, Swift, TypeScript
Last synced: 21 Jan 2025
https://github.com/alexcitten/shardingipfs
Implementation of sharding with IPFS.
blockchain data-sharding data-shards ipfs ipfs-api ipfs-blockchain ipfs-core ipfs-node ipfs-nodes ipfs-sharding ipfs-shards
Last synced: 21 Jan 2025
https://github.com/rubeniskov/cuser
Distributed messaging service 🌐, with no database, no config and using IPFS layer to distribute the storage all over the universe ♾️.
cid conversation hash ipfs messaging service
Last synced: 11 Apr 2025
https://github.com/elek/easypin
Smart-contract based IPFS service based on STORJ backend
decentralized ipfs storage storj
Last synced: 14 Apr 2025
https://github.com/igi-111/hydria
a simple encrypted distributed state container
container distributed encryption ipfs yjs
Last synced: 13 Apr 2025